F16 Specialization for MeanStdDevNorm
Ran into issues with f16 meanstddevnorm. Essentially, with large enough tensors and/or large values in tensors, output becomes all 0. This is due to the variance computation. In f16, it reaches infinity quite easily, then the division results in 0. This change modifies the OpenCL and NEON implementations to compute the sum of squares and the variance using f32, while other operations remain f16. Update: Found that the square operation also benefits from f32, rather than squaring in f16 and accumulating f32.
